Bello sapere che vengono ancora prodotte schede madri con controller floppy:
<http://www.ebay.it/itm/Gigabyte-GA-P55-USB3-Rev-2-0-Intel-P55-Mainboard-ATX-Sockel-1156-31789-/111833137984?hash=item1a09c64340:g:SWQAAOSwnHZYjM2u#rwid>http://www.ebay.it/itm/Gigabyte-GA-P55-USB3-Rev-2-0-Intel-P55-Mainboard-ATX-Sockel-1156-31789-/111833137984?hash=item1a09c64340:g:SWQAAOSwnHZYjM2u#rwid

Anche se gestisce un solo drive.

Secondo Simon Owen però queste schede usano "some kind of super i/o chip that includes basic floppy support. Some can't handle FM-encoded disks, and some also have problems with 128-byte sectors, but those limitations won't be a problem for QL disks."

Immagino quindi (ma gli ho chiesto conferma. Quando mi risponde vi riferisco) che non possano gestire i floppies Disciple/MGT da 800KB o comunque formati strani...
